Stamatis Spanoudakis was born in Athens Greece.
Early on he studied classical guitar. Later on he studied Byzantine music He first studied Classical music ( guitar and theory ).
He went through a rock music phase, but then continued classical studies at the Würzburg State Conservatory with Bertold Hummel and later in Athens with Konstantinos Kydoniatis. Very early on he began to occupy himself with music He later played bass guitar and keyboards in a number of bands, in the sixties and the seventies, in Athens, Paris and London where he lived and recorded his first albums.
He later returned to Classical music and resumed his studies of composition, first in Wurzburg Germany with professor Bertold Hummel and then in Athens with professor Konstantinos Kydoniatis.
He was then attracted to his third love - Byzantine music, which led him to Greek songwriting and instrumental music Since then he is consciously trying to reconcile his three musical influences (Rock, classical and Byzantine), in his music
He wrote numerous hit songs (words and music) for most major Greek singers. He also wrote the music for many successful films in Greece, Germany and Italy, for the theater and television and has recorded so far more than sixty albums.
Since 1995, he concentrates on instrumental music, based on Greek historical or religious themes, a music that has an unprecedent appeal in Greece.
He has his own studio where he records his music, being the composer, arranger, producer, performer and engineer of his work.
